Abstract

Piperidine derivatives are highly abundant in natural products and pharmaceutically relevant compounds. Aza‐Prins cyclization has emerged as a step‐ atom‐economical and stereoselective method for the preparation of such azacycles. The possibility of coupling aza‐Prins process with the formation of a second cycle in a one‐pot manner is even more powerful and makes the object of this review. Cascade/domino/tandem bis‐cyclizations involving an aza‐Prins process, for the rapid construction of complex small molecules, are discussed in detail.
